Are you ready to join a community leading in innovative teaching and learning? Kennesaw State University is one of the 50 largest public institutions in the country.

With our growing enrollment and global reach, we are enjoying increased prominence among Georgia's colleges. We offer more than 150 undergraduate, graduate, and doctoral degrees to over 43,000 students. Our entrepreneurial spirit, high-impact research, and Division I athletics also draw students from throughout the region and from 92 countries across the globe.

Job Summary

Develops, organizes and implements comprehensive programs in the assigned college, department and/or unit. Responsible for preparing and organizing programs and activities.

Promotes programs internal and external to the university and evaluates effectiveness. Ensures programs comply with university and USG policies and procedures.

Responsibilities

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ES*:

1.Develops, prepares, coordinates and implements assigned programs

2.Manages and facilitates department communications including program marketing, website creation, mobile applications and social media

3.Serves as liaison and communicates with academic divisions, colleges and departments

4.May assists in developing, monitoring and managing budget processes

5.Manages event planning, marketing and logistics

6.Interprets, evaluates, develops and implements policies and procedures

7.Creates, administers, and analyzes assessment programs

8.Facilitates program components, post-program evaluation and operational reporting

9.Assists with developing new programming



  1. Prepares operational reports and analysis to inform center-level reporting and decision-making

  2. May supervise assigned staff and/or student assistants
